Comments:
This inspection was conducted by licensing staff using an alternate remote protocol, necessary due to a state of emergency health pandemic declared by the Governor of Virginia.

A complaint inspection was initiated on 11/09/2020 and concluded on 12/08/2020. A complaint was received by the department regarding allegations in the areas of admission and resident care and related services. The owner was contacted by telephone to conduct the investigation. The licensing inspector emailed the owner and the administrator a list of documentation required to complete the investigation.

The evidence gathered during the investigation did not support the allegations of non-compliance with standards or law; however, any violations not related to the complaint but identified during the course of the investigation can be found on the violation notice.

Standard #: 22VAC40-73-680-D
Complaint related: No
Description: Based on resident record review and staff interview, the facility failed to ensure that medications were administered in accordance with the physician?s or other prescriber?s instructions.

EVIDENCE:

1. The record for resident 1, admitted on 10/23/2020, contained a signed physician?s order, ?Order Reconciliation?, dated 10/22/2020 for polyethylene glycol 3350 17 gram oral powder packet to be administered one time a day for constipation.

This medication was not included on the October and November 2020 medication administration records (MARs) for resident 1, nor did the record contain documentation that the medication had been administered. Interview with staff 1 on 12/10/2020 confirmed that polyethylene glycol had not been administered to resident 1.

The record for resident 1 contained a note by ?Encompass Home Health?, dated 10/30/2020, that ?Pt found in her room, alert et (and) crying in pain. Pt states she has been in pain off et (and) on all night. Pt has had 0 BM X 3 days (with) decreased bowel sounds et (and) order written to give MOM (Milk of Magnesia) daily till successful BM, then QOD.?

2. The record for resident 1, admitted on 10/23/2020, contained a signed physician?s order, ?Order Reconciliation?, dated 10/22/2020 for metoprolol succinate ER 25 mg extended release 24 hr (12.5 mg) to be administered two times a day. The physician?s order showed ?Notes: BP and/or Pulse Hold: Diastolic Blood Pressure is < 60.00 Pulse is < 60.00 * Systolic Blood Pressure is < 100.00 BP and/or Pulse Hold: *Systolic Blood Pressure < 100 Hold; Diastolic Blood Pressure < 60 Hold; Pulse < 60 Hold ; HTN?

The October and November 2020 medication administration records (MARs) for resident 1 showed that metoprolol succ ER 25 MG ?Take ? TABLET = (12.5MG) BY MOUTH 2 TIMES A DAY FOR HYPERTENSION? was administered to the resident daily at 8:00AM from 10/24/2020 through 11/02/2020 and daily at 8:00PM from 10/23/2020 through 11/02/2020.

The record for resident 1 did not contain documentation that the resident?s blood pressure and pulse was taken by staff to determine whether the medication should be administered or held. Interview with staff 1 on 12/10/2020 confirmed that blood pressure and pulse was not taken by staff for resident 1 prior to administering metoprolol succinate ER 25 mg on these dates/times.

Plan of Correction: I. All resident medications are being administered in accordance with the physician?s or other prescriber?s instructions.
II. Administrator and/or designee will audit all current resident records to ensure each are receiving medications as prescribed.
III. Administrator and/or designee will randomly audit two (2) resident records per month to ensure ongoing compliance.
IV. Date of completion: March 1st, 2021
